Hidden Household Pests



Are you familiar with the concealed family bugs that may be hiding in your house? While you may be vigilant about typical insects like ants or spiders, there are various other tricky trespassers that could be causing damage behind the scenes.



One such insect is the silverfish, a tiny insect that grows in damp and dark atmospheres like basements and bathrooms. These pests can harm books, clothing, and also wallpaper, making them an annoyance to manage.

Additionally, mold mites are typically neglected but can indicate a dampness problem in your house. These little creatures eat mold and mildew and can worsen allergic reactions for sensitive individuals. Maintaining your home completely dry and well-ventilated can help avoid these bugs from taking up residence in your home.

Unwelcome Intruders



Unwanted burglars can disrupt your house tranquility and cause damage if not handled promptly. While pests like rodents and cockroaches are generally known, various other lesser-known burglars like silverfish and rug beetles can additionally wreak havoc in your home. Silverfish are little, wingless insects that grow in damp locations and eat starchy materials like paper and glue, creating damages to publications, wallpaper, and apparel. Rug beetles, on the other hand, delight in a selection of things such as carpetings, garments, and furniture, causing expensive damage if left unattended.

These undesirable burglars not only damage your personal belongings yet can also position health dangers. Rats and cockroaches, for example, can spread out conditions through their droppings and urine, polluting surfaces and food. Silverfish and carpet beetles can trigger allergies in some individuals, leading to skin irritation and respiratory system issues.

To avoid these intruders from taking over your home, it's crucial to keep cleanliness, seal entrance factors, and without delay deal with any kind of indications of infestation. Sneaky Home Invaders



While you may be diligent in keeping your home tidy and arranged, tricky home intruders can still locate their method undetected. These pests are masters of concealing in ordinary sight, making it important to remain attentive in identifying their presence.

Here are a few sly home invaders you need to keep an eye out for:

2. ** Carpet Beetles **: Often mistaken for harmless ladybugs, carpet beetles can damage your home. Their larvae feed upon all-natural fibers like wool and silk, creating permanent damages to carpets, garments, and upholstery.

3. ** Earwigs **: Regardless of their ominous-looking pincers, earwigs are more of a nuisance than a threat. They're attracted to moisture and can find their way right into your home with fractures and crevices. Watch out for them in damp locations like bathroom and kitchens.
